Do the pyglet examples display correctly?* I do not think that the stencil buffer is broken. I think it is the openGL Config (pyglet.gl.Config) what does not work. I have tried other examples and old codes that work correctly when the openGL Config is not enabled. However, when I initialize the window in the following way, the pyglet window is completely blank: allowstencil = pyglet.gl.Config() > window = pyglet.window.Window(config = allowstencil) Note that the pyglet.gl.Config() call is empty, but if I add the stencil option (below), the pyglet window is still blank. > allowstencil = pyglet.gl.Config(stencil_size=8) > window = pyglet.window.Window(config = allowstencil) And yes, I have the latest driver for my GPU.
